For Canadian viewers, if you are using Firefox, install the following addon.From Reddit.
Then:
1) In Firefox, Go to tools->modify headers.
2) From the drop down box on the left select add.
3) Then enter: "X-Forwarded-For" in the first input box without the quotation marks
4) Enter: "12.13.14.15" in the second input box without the quotation marks.
5) Leave the last input box empty, and save the filter, and enable it. Example.
6) Click the 'Configuration' tab on the right then proceed to check the 'always on' button.
Close the Modify Headers box and it should work.
